Author: Victor Castano, Igor Schagaev Full Title: Resilient Computer System Design Publisher: Springer; 2015 edition (April 16, 2015) Year: 2015 ISBN-13: 9783319150697 (978-3-319-15069-7), 9783319150680 (978-3-319-15068-0), 9783319386058 (978-3-319-38605-8) ISBN-10: 3319150693, 3319150685, 3319386050 Pages: 256 Language: English Genre: Engineering: Signals & Communication File type: PDF (True) Quality: 10/10 Price: 93.59 € This book presents a paradigm for designing new generation resilient and evolving computer systems, including their key concepts, elements of supportive theory, methods of analysis and synthesis of ICT with new properties of evolving functioning, as well as implementation schemes and their prototyping. The book explains why new ICT applications require a complete redesign of computer systems to address challenges of extreme reliability, high performance, and power efficiency. The authors present a comprehensive treatment for designing the next generation of computers, especially addressing safety critical, autonomous, real time, military, banking, and wearable health care systems. ------------- Our members see more.
